RIVERVIEW — A 35-year-old man who was speeding the afternoon of March 7 on southbound Grange Road near Meadows Drive was subject to a traffic stop, which revealed his driver’s license, issued in New York, was suspended.
The man had never acquired a Michigan driver’s license, but because he lived in Riverview and had two small children in the car, he was allowed to wait for a licensed driver to arrive at the scene, instead of his silver Audi Q7 being impounded and towed.
He was cited for driving with a suspended license.
